The IMPACT boots offer the ultimate cold comfort in the Baffin lineup. Tested at both the North and South Poles, they're built to handle the toughest weather. Key features include a double - buckle fastening for extra security, a nylon locking snow collar to shield from the elements. The Arctic™ Rubber shell provides lightweight flexibility, cold - resistance, and resilience. An EVA midsole offers lightweight insulation and cushioning. The Polar Rubber® outsole ensures great grip and long - lasting performance in cold temperatures. The removable Comfort - Fit multi - layer inner boot system has a Thermaplush™ wicking layer for warmth, a form - fitting B - Tek™ Foam lining for comfort, and Double B - Tek™ Heat insulation for breathability across a wide temperature range. It also features a Vaporized Aluminum Membrane for heat regulation, a PolyWool blend for breathable warmth, Hydromax™ layering for moisture management, Diamond Net insulation for wind protection, a waffle - comb footbed to trap warm air and control odor, and a double aluminum insole to retain body heat.






Using these Baffin boots is straightforward. Just put them on like any regular boots and fasten the double buckles for a secure fit. When you're out in snowy conditions, make sure the nylon locking snow collar is properly adjusted to keep snow out. For maintenance, after each use, wipe off any dirt or snow with a damp cloth. Let the boots dry naturally in a well - ventilated area; avoid using direct heat sources as it can damage the materials. Replace the removable inner boot system periodically to maintain its comfort and performance. Remember, these boots are designed for cold - weather use, so don't use them in extremely hot conditions as it may affect their functionality.
